A geometrical interpretation of the structural parameter of chalcopyrite (E11) type compounds ABC2

Abstract

Compounds ABC2 of the chalcopyrite type are classified from a geometrical point of view according to the dependence of the axial ratio c/a on the structural parameter u. They belong to one out of 18 classes where certain pairs of interatomic distances (not necessarily nearest neighbour distances) are equal for all members of the class. Due to their limited accuracy, the experimental data c/a = f(u) of 30 compounds were sorted into 4 families the unit cell distortion of which is quite different. Hitherto unknown structural parameters have been predicted from the axial ratio of the compounds.
